Transaction 43ff7f75cb93bc08f204a75a2bbbbaf789c6424022d0a4067ba392a55f71e746
2 Input
2 Outputs
- 43ff7f75cb93bc08f204a75a2bbbbaf789c6424022d0a4067ba392a55f71e746:0
- 43ff7f75cb93bc08f204a75a2bbbbaf789c6424022d0a4067ba392a55f71e746:1
value 904345
address 1CgWN5D1Ex4yMGSqFMEZEuhvEaz3D7rheM
value 2857176
address 1EQXdZGn9Fctk76xSYU2EsV5QvdoPHrQkw